{{tag>matériel wi-fi}}
----
====== Livebox : Installation du pilote pour le dongle XG-703A (Sagem), sous Edgy Eft: ======
Note : Sous [[:Gutsy]]/[[:Hardy]] le dongle marche dès le branchement, il suffit ensuite de sélectionner le réseau dans network-manager.
Sous Gusty, Hardy et Intrepid, la connexion peut être aléatoire, dans ce cas il faut suivre la procédure ci-dessous mais en blacklistant le module p54usb à la place des deux indiqués.
Sous Lucid, le dongle n'est plus reconnu nativement, la procédure décrite ci dessous n'a pas l'air de fonctionner.
Chez moi ça fonctionne sous Lucid. L'étape 1 est cependant inutile car les modules islsm et islsm_usb ne sont pas chargés par défaut (je suis sur ubuntu serveur 10.04).
J'ai fait après l'étape 6 les deux commandes suivantes : dmesg
sudo dhclient wlan0
Et ça fonctionne !
Sur Ubuntu Lucid, et Ubuntustudio Lucid la procedure décrite ci-dessus fonctionne parfaitement chez moi.
Pour faire fonctionner ce dongle, il suffit d'installer le paquet " linux-firmware-nonfree " (voir [[http://forum.ubuntu-fr.org/viewtopic.php?pid=3747632#p3747632]]). Testé sur Ubuntu 10.04 Lucid Lynx 64 bits. Testé également sur Ubuntu 11.10 The Oneiric Ocelot.
Sous Natty Narwhal 11.04 voir : [[http://forum.ubuntu-fr.org/viewtopic.php?pid=4244881#p4248241|http://forum.ubuntu-fr.org/viewtopic.php?pid=4244881#p4248241]]
=== 0 - Récupérer les fichiers du pilote Windows ===
* sur le Net : [[http://www.orange.fr/bin/frame.cgi?u=http%3A//assistance.orange.fr/1425.php]]
* sur le CD fourni avec la LiveBox (/Windows/WiFi/XG703A/Driver/Drivers.zip).
=== 1 - Blacklister les modules activés par defaut ===
Editer le fichier :
gksudo gedit /etc/modprobe.d/blacklist
Ajouter a la fin :
blacklist islsm
blacklist islsm_usb
Décharger islsm et islsm_usb (ou rebooter...) :
sudo modprobe -r islsm
sudo modprobe -r islsm_usb
=== 2 - Installer l'utilitaire ndiswrapper, derniere version ===
sudo apt-get install ndiswrapper-utils-1.9
=== 3 - Installer le pilote Windows (WlanUIG.inf) a l'aide de ndiswrapper ===
Se placer dans le repertoire contenant le fichier WlanUIG.inf :
cd répertoire_où_se_trouve_le_pilote //(WlanUIG.inf)
L'installer :
sudo ndiswrapper-1.9 -i WlanUIG.inf
=== 4 - Verifier que tout s'est bien déroulé : ===
sudo ndiswrapper-1.9 -l
doit retouner quelquechose comme :
Installed drivers:
wlanuig driver installed, hardware present
Ce qui indique que le pilote est en phase avec le matériel détecté et que la clé est branchée et reconnue.
=== 5 - Créer le nouveau module : ===
sudo ndiswrapper -m
=== 6 - Charger le module : ===
sudo modprobe ndiswrapper
=== 7 - Faire se charger le module au démarrage : ===
Editer le fichier :
gksudo gedit /etc/modules
Ajouter a la fin :
ndiswrapper
Puis lancer la commande qui va charger le module ndiswrapper dans le noyaux:
sudo modprobe ndiswrapper
=== 9 - Configurer la connexion (Système > Administration > Réseau) : ===
\\
ESSID : Wanadoo_XXXX \\
hexadecimal \\
clé WEP : XXXXXXXXXXXXXXXXXXXXXXXXXX \\
(Cf. a recopier depuis la boite de la LiveBox) sans les espaces. \\
=== 10 - That's all folks ===